Md Billal Hossain is a highly skilled Senior Biomedical (Clinical Data and Algorithm) Engineer at Analog Devices since July 2023. Prior to this role, Hossain served as a Graduate Research Assistant at the University of Connecticut from January 2019 to June 2023, where responsibilities included designing human subjects protocols, preparing IRB documents, and analyzing physiological data. A brief tenure as a Contractual Research Scientist at ScottCare Cardiovascular Solutions involved obtaining FDA approval for the Arrio device and working on ECG data adjudication. Hossain's experience also includes a Graduate Teaching Assistant position at the University of Texas at Arlington and lecturing at Daffodil International University-DIU. Hossain holds a Ph.D. in Biomedical/Medical Engineering and a Master's degree in Electrical Engineering from the University of Connecticut, along with a Bachelor's degree in Electrical and Electronics Engineering from Bangladesh University of Engineering and Technology.
